HANOVER, N.H. - The Bridgewater equestrian team fell to No. 4 Dartmouth on Saturday due to a tiebreaker.
In fences the Big Green took three of the four points with
Kelsey Quinn claiming the only point for BC with a score of 77.Â
In the flat it was a completely different story with the Eagles taking three of the four points.
Caroline Warren won a point for BC with a score of 79 which was the second highest of all of the flat performances. Quinn was the only person to outscore her with an 86 earning her Most Outstanding Performance. Ellie Weinreb picked up the third point for BC in the flat.Â
The meet came down to a tiebreaker based on total scores awarding Dartmouth the win after they outscored BC 598-486 in total.
